Compartir a través de


AzureWorkloadPointInTimeRestoreRequest Constructores

Definición

Sobrecargas

AzureWorkloadPointInTimeRestoreRequest()

Inicializa una nueva instancia de la clase AzureWorkloadPointInTimeRestoreRequest.

AzureWorkloadPointInTimeRestoreRequest(String, String, IDictionary<String,String>, TargetRestoreInfo, String, String, Nullable<DateTime>)

Inicializa una nueva instancia de la clase AzureWorkloadPointInTimeRestoreRequest.

AzureWorkloadPointInTimeRestoreRequest()

Inicializa una nueva instancia de la clase AzureWorkloadPointInTimeRestoreRequest.

public AzureWorkloadPointInTimeRestoreRequest ();
Public Sub New ()

Se aplica a

AzureWorkloadPointInTimeRestoreRequest(String, String, IDictionary<String,String>, TargetRestoreInfo, String, String, Nullable<DateTime>)

Inicializa una nueva instancia de la clase AzureWorkloadPointInTimeRestoreRequest.

public AzureWorkloadPointInTimeRestoreRequest (string recoveryType = default, string sourceResourceId = default, System.Collections.Generic.IDictionary<string,string> propertyBag = default, Microsoft.Azure.Management.RecoveryServices.Backup.CrossRegionRestore.Models.TargetRestoreInfo targetInfo = default, string recoveryMode = default, string targetVirtualMachineId = default, DateTime? pointInTime = default);
new Microsoft.Azure.Management.RecoveryServices.Backup.CrossRegionRestore.Models.AzureWorkloadPointInTimeRestoreRequest : string * string * System.Collections.Generic.IDictionary<string, string> * Microsoft.Azure.Management.RecoveryServices.Backup.CrossRegionRestore.Models.TargetRestoreInfo * string * string * Nullable<DateTime> -> Microsoft.Azure.Management.RecoveryServices.Backup.CrossRegionRestore.Models.AzureWorkloadPointInTimeRestoreRequest
Public Sub New (Optional recoveryType As String = Nothing, Optional sourceResourceId As String = Nothing, Optional propertyBag As IDictionary(Of String, String) = Nothing, Optional targetInfo As TargetRestoreInfo = Nothing, Optional recoveryMode As String = Nothing, Optional targetVirtualMachineId As String = Nothing, Optional pointInTime As Nullable(Of DateTime) = Nothing)

Parámetros

recoveryType
String

Tipo de esta recuperación. Entre los valores posibles se incluyen: 'Invalid', 'OriginalLocation', 'AlternateLocation', 'RestoreDisks', 'Offline'

sourceResourceId
String

Identificador completo de ARM de la máquina virtual en la que se está recuperando la carga de trabajo que se estaba ejecutando.

propertyBag
IDictionary<String,String>

Contenedor de propiedades específico de la carga de trabajo.

targetInfo
TargetRestoreInfo

Detalles de la base de datos de destino

recoveryMode
String

Define si el modo de recuperación actual es la restauración de archivos o la restauración de la base de datos. Entre los valores posibles se incluyen: "Invalid", "FileRecovery", "WorkloadRecovery"

targetVirtualMachineId
String

Este es el identificador de ARM completo de la máquina virtual de destino. Por ejemplo, /subscriptions/{subId}/resourcegroups/{rg}/provider/Microsoft.Compute/virtualmachines/{vm}

pointInTime
Nullable<DateTime>

Valor pointInTime

Se aplica a